The problem with that, the WHIR, etc, is that when you advertise, you're advertising next to 50 of your competitors. Not a good place to be. Why not carve out a niche for yourself in a market (i.e. podcast hosting, forum hosting, etc). You could find a community (i.e. programmers, designers (think of what MediaTemple has done in the designer community!), etc) and market to them. The competition won't be as fierce and it will be much easier to build something unique -
something no one else has.
